Output 4abcf7f7f8acaa505670826f7c9442b8f776273a687f8cc5675fb7ae2561c0be:0

value
17778400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81bb418619dfaf1f823290a452e8847a9f1bb843 OP_EQUAL
address
3DWyR4XJk4FSEW9Cv3Uoajrk2eGrRA3ZEe
transaction
4abcf7f7f8acaa505670826f7c9442b8f776273a687f8cc5675fb7ae2561c0be
confirmations
383218
spent
true